From my understanding, Aggie Assurance only covers tuition and not fees, books, etc. It makes sure you have enough grants/scholarships to cover tuition. So, if you got a $2,000 Pell Grant per semester, you're guaranteed ~$2,400 in other grants to cover the rest of tuition. I was really surprised at how poor A&M's aid package was compared to other schools.

When I was in the financial aid office last month, they weren't even aware transfers were eligible for Aggie Assurance. They pulled out a binder that had the same info available on the website and referenced that. After verifying, they said the provost will go back through each financial aid file and change the distribution of loans/grants for those eligible for AA.
